About Thore Graepel

Thore Graepel is a scholar working on Artificial Intelligence, Management Science and Operations Research, Computer Vision and Pattern Recognition, Sociology and Political Science and Statistical and Nonlinear Physics, having authored 104 papers that have together received 21.0k indexed citations. Recurring topics across this work include Machine Learning and Algorithms (22 papers), Reinforcement Learning in Robotics (13 papers), Artificial Intelligence in Games (12 papers), Neural Networks and Applications (11 papers), Experimental Behavioral Economics Studies (10 papers), Face and Expression Recognition (9 papers), Machine Learning and Data Classification (9 papers) and Advanced Bandit Algorithms Research (9 papers). The work is most often cited by research in Artificial Intelligence (10.7k citations), Health Informatics (225 citations), Computer Vision and Pattern Recognition (2.9k citations), Management Science and Operations Research (1.4k citations) and Computational Theory and Mathematics (1.5k citations). Thore Graepel has collaborated with scholars based in United Kingdom, United States and Germany. Frequent co-authors include David Silver, Demis Hassabis, Timothy Lillicrap, Julian Schrittwieser, Laurent Sifre, Arthur Guez, Ioannis Antonoglou, George van den Driessche, Aja Huang and Michał Kosiński. Their work appears in journals such as Nature, Machine Learning, Science, ACM SIGPLAN Notices and Journal of Machine Learning Research.
